Onward to more machinery, Tetsuo: Iron Man! Yow! Rampant cybersextechnobody fear! This'n pulls out all the phobias of our modern lives and wraps 'em in cold uncaring flesh/metal then keeps hittin ya over the head with it until yer a part of it, laughin and paranoid, lookin around for somethin to crush! From the minute this movie starts yer trapped, entangled in all the wire, scrap metal, blood and filth, and the coolest thing about it is, you don't mind! Director Shinya Tsukamoto lets you into his character's mind and allows you to experience his disgust, arousal, fear of himself and everyone/everything around him. And by the time he becomes a huge, lumbering, metal monster roamin the streets of Japan, you know exactly how he feels!! All this with hardly any dialogue or translation! This is a movie filled with effects, the kind ya feel not just watch, as a man becomes his environment: a walkin, stompin, junkyard on the warpath! After watchin this we felt numb and crazed at the same time and that, to us, is an ultra-enjoyable experience! Changin the oil in yer car will never be the same again!!
